Spider-Man: The Bear Facts

fuzzy & softy

Given the sudden emergence of cute, fuzzy animals in the blogoverse, Fuzzy and Softy thought it high time they add their two cents to the Fortress’ Four-Color Annals of Super Spandex-dom.

In case you missed their earlier visit, Fuzzy and Softy spend most of their days reading Archie Comics, playing MLB 2006: The Show and running around with Fortress Boy.

Inspired by their mentor and hero, Bully, the two decided to branch out and read a few super-hero comics.

Since they enjoyed the Keeper’s collection of Ralph Bakshi Spider-Man cartoons, they agreed to sample three books featuring the one and only friendly neighborhood web-slinger.

Let’s see what they think …

Amazing Spider-Man #535

Synopsis: After touring the Negative Zone gulag built by Mr. Fantastic and Iron Man, Peter finally figures out he’s working for a pair of fascist super-villains.

Ultimate Spider-Man #100

Synopsis: The Ultimate Clone Saga reaches a thrilling climax as Peter’s father returns from the grave! But, what’s happening to Mary Jane?

Spider-Man Loves Mary Jane #10

Synopsis: Mary Jane is going to star in a play, but she’s more worried about Peter and Gwen’s growing friendship. Meanwhile, will Flash Thompson ruin everything?

Softy: Who’s that girl with Spider-Man?

Fortress Keeper: Mary Jane.

Fuzzy: Is she like Betty or Veronica?

Fortress Keeper: Well, in the old days Mary Jane was sort of like Veronica and Gwen, this other girl in the story, was sort of like Betty. But now, they’re both kind of like Betty.
